Understanding the Requirements
Before we dive into the connection process, it’s essential to understand the requirements for connecting Uverse to Samsung Smart TV. Here are a few things you’ll need to get started:
- A Samsung Smart TV (2013 model or later)
- A Uverse receiver (such as the Total Home DVR or the Wireless Receiver)
- A Uverse subscription with a compatible TV package
- A stable internet connection
- An HDMI cable

Connecting Uverse to Samsung Smart TV
Now that you’ve checked your subscription, it’s time to connect your Uverse service to your Samsung Smart TV.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you get started:
Step 1: Connect the Uverse Receiver to Your Samsung Smart TV
The first step is to connect your Uverse receiver to your Samsung Smart TV using an HDMI cable. Here’s how:
- Locate the HDMI ports on the back of your Samsung Smart TV
- Connect one end of the HDMI cable to the Uverse receiver and the other end to the Samsung Smart TV
- Make sure to note the HDMI port number on your Samsung Smart TV, as you’ll need this information later
Step 2: Set Up the Uverse Receiver
Once you’ve connected the Uverse receiver to your Samsung Smart TV, it’s time to set it up. Here’s how:
- Turn on your Samsung Smart TV and the Uverse receiver
- Use the Uverse remote control to navigate to the “Settings” menu
- Select “System Setup” and then “TV Setup”
-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the setup process

Troubleshooting Common Issues
While connecting Uverse to Samsung Smart TV is a relatively straightforward process, you may encounter some common issues along the way. Here are some troubleshooting tips to help you resolve any problems:
No Signal or Weak Signal
If you’re experiencing a weak or no signal on your Samsung Smart TV, try the following:
- Check the HDMI connection to ensure that it’s secure and not loose
- Try switching to a different HDMI port on your Samsung Smart TV
- Restart the Uverse receiver and Samsung Smart TV to see if this resolves the issue
Uverse App Not Working
If the Uverse app is not working on your Samsung Smart TV, try the following:
- Check that you’ve activated the Uverse app correctly
- Ensure that your Samsung Smart TV is connected to the internet
- Restart the Uverse receiver and Samsung Smart TV to see if this resolves the issue

How do I connect the Uverse receiver to my Samsung Smart TV?
To connect the Uverse receiver to Samsung Smart TV, users need to follow a few steps. First, they need to connect the HDMI cable to the receiver and the TV. The HDMI cable should be connected to the HDMI OUT port on the receiver and the HDMI IN port on the TV. Next, users need to turn on the TV and the receiver, and then select the correct HDMI input on the TV using the TV’s remote control.
Once the connection is established, users can access Uverse content using the TV’s remote control or the Uverse app on their TV. They can also use the Uverse receiver’s remote control to navigate through the Uverse menu and access different features. It’s also important to ensure that the receiver is properly configured and that the TV is set to the correct input.
